The objective of this study was to evaluate the effect of nitrogen and potassium silicate on the production and commercial aspects of curly lettuce, Vera cultivar. The experimental design was completely randomized (CRD), with ten treatments an d three replications. The tr eatments, arranged in a factorial design according to the Plan Puebla III matrix (Turrent & Laird, 1975), consisted of the combination of five do ses of nitrogen (9; 54; 90; 126, and 171 kg ha -1 ) and five doses of potassium silicate (1.15; 6.90; 11.50; 16.10, and 21.85 kg ha -1 ). A control treatment without application of nitrogen and potassium silicate was also inserted. The crop was gr own in a greenhouse, and the doses were applied as sidedressing using a drip micro-i rrigation system. Total fresh matter, commercial fresh matter, non- commercial fresh matter, number of leaves and commercial trade index were evaluated. The commercial fresh matter and the number of commercial leaves per plant were affected only by nitrogen fertigation and increased linearly with an increase in the dose of nitr ogen, with the best response s observed at the highest dose of this element (171 kg ha -1 ). Potassium silicate only had an effect on non-commercial fresh matter, with no influence on the other characteristics.
